The first telescope “the starry Galileo” constructed with a leaden
tube a few inches long, with a spectacle-glass, one convex and one
concave, at each of its extremities. It magnified three times.
Telescopes were made in London in February 1610, a year after
Galileo had completed his own (Rigaud, _On Harriot’s Papers_,
1833). They were at first called _cylinders_. The telescopes which
Galileo constructed, and others of which he made use for observing
Jupiter’s satellites, the phases of Venus, and the solar spots,
possessed the gradually-increasing powers of magnifying four,
seven, and thirty-two linear diameters; but they never had a higher
power.--Arago, in the _Annuaire_ for 1842.
Clock-work is now applied to the equatorial telescope, so as to
allow the observer to follow the course of any star, comet, or
planet he may wish to observe continuously, without using his hands
for the mechanical motion of the instrument.
ANTIQUITY OF TELESCOPES.
Long tubes were certainly employed by Arabian astronomers, and very
probably also by the Greeks and Romans; the exactness of their
observations being in some degree attributable to their causing the
object to be seen through diopters or slits. Abul Hassan speaks very
distinctly of tubes, to the extremities of which ocular and object
diopters were attached; and instruments so constructed were used in
the observatory founded by Hulagu at Meragha. If stars be more easily
discovered during twilight by means of tubes, and if a star be sooner
revealed to the naked eye through a tube than without it, the reason
lies, as Arago has truly observed, in the circumstance that the tube
conceals a great portion of the disturbing light diffused in the
atmospheric strata between the star and the eye applied to the tube.
In like manner, the tube prevents the lateral impression of the faint
light which the particles of air receive at night from all the other
stars in the firmament. The intensity of the image and the size of the
star are apparently augmented.--_Humboldt’s Cosmos_, vol. iii. p. 53.
NEWTON’S FIRST REFLECTING TELESCOPE.
The year 1668 may be regarded as the date of the invention of
Newton’s Reflecting Telescope. Five years previously, James Gregory
had described the manner of constructing a reflecting telescope with
two concave specula; but Newton perceived the disadvantages to be so
great, that, according to his statement, he “found it necessary, before
attempting any thing in the practice, to alter the design, and place
the eye-glass at the side of the tube rather than at the middle.” On
this improved principle Newton constructed his telescope, which was
examined by Charles II.; it was presented to the Royal Society near the
end of 1671, and is carefully preserved by that distinguished body,
with the inscription:
“THE FIRST REFLECTING TELESCOPE; INVENTED BY SIR ISAAC NEWTON, AND
MADE WITH HIS OWN HANDS.”
